William & Mary rallies to first CAA win, 24-17 over Delaware
WILLIAMSBURG, Va. -- Steve Cluley helped rally his team to score three touchdowns in the fourth quarter and William & Mary notched its first Colonial Athletic Conference win, beating Delaware 24-17 on Saturday.
Cluley had 204 yards passing and ran for a score for the Tribe (3-4, 1-3). Kendall Anderson ran for 115 yards and a touchdown and Aaron Swinton had a 63-yard interception return for a score.
With his team trailing 14-3 early in the fourth, Cluley took William & Mary 80 yards and Anderson scored the Tribe's first touchdown to narrow the gap to 14-10. After a successful onside kick, Cluley capped a 54-yard drive with a short touchdown run that put the Tribe on top 17-14 with 4:12 left.
Swinton picked off Delaware's Joe Walker on the Blue Hens' (2-4, 0-3) ensuing drive and went 63 yards for another touchdown.
Walker had 112 yards passing, 109 rushing and ran for a score.
